Starting Current and Specified Accuracy Current Range definitions in ION meters

Issue
Starting Current and Specified Accuracy Current Range definitions are device characteristics that help to understanding the operational capabilities of the device.

Product
ION9000, PM8000, ION7400, ION8650, ION8800, ION7650

Resolution

  • Starting Current: The Starting Current is the minimum current level at which the meter begins to register and measure current flow. This means that while starting current can be measured, the accuracy of that measurement may not match the stated accuracy for meter current. For example, Starting Current  in ION9000, is 1 milliamp (mA) which is beneficial for detecting very low levels of current. It ensures that even small amounts of current are detected and measured, which is important for applications where low current detection is necessary, but may not match the stated accuracy.
  • Specified Accuracy Current Range: The Specified Accuracy Current Range indicates the current levels within which the meter can measure with its specified accuracy.
    For example, the Specified accuracy current range in ION9000 is 10mA – 20A, this means it can accurately measure(IEC61557-12 Class0.1) currents from 10 milliamps (mA) to 20 amps (A). Operating within the stated accuracy range ensures that the meter provides reliable and precise readings. If the current falls outside this range, the accuracy of the measurements may not be guaranteed.
